Java&Xml教程(十一)JAXB实现XML与Java对象转换

  • JAXBContext类,是应用的入口,用于管理XML/Java绑定信息。

  • Marshaller接口,将Java对象序列化为XML数据。

  • Unmarshaller接口,将XML数据反序列化为Java对象。

  • @XmlType,将Java类或枚举类型映射到XML模式类型

  • @XmlAccessorType(XmlAccessType.FIELD),控制字段或属性的序列化。FIELD表示JAXB将自动绑定Java类中的每个非静态的(static)、非瞬态的(由@XmlTransient标注)字段到XML。其他值还有XmlAccessType.PROPERTY和XmlAccessType.NONE。

  • @XmlAccessorOrder,控制JAXB 绑定类中属性和字段的排序

  • @XmlJavaTypeAdapter,使用定制的适配器(即扩展抽象类XmlAdapter并覆盖marshal()和unmarshal()方法),以序列化Java类为XML。

  • @XmlElementWrapper ,对于数组或集合(即包含多个元素的成员变量),生成一个包装该数组或集合的XML元素(称为包装器)。

  • @XmlRootElement,将Java类或枚举类型映射到XML元素。

  • @XmlElement,将Java类的一个属性映射到与属性同名的一个XML元素。

  • @XmlAttribute,将Java类的一个属性映射到与属性同名的一个XML属性。

package net.csdn.beans;  import javax.xml.bind.annotation.XmlAccessType;  import javax.xml.bind.annotation.XmlAccessorType;  import javax.xml.bind.annotation.XmlRootElement;  import javax.xml.bind.annotation.XmlType;  @XmlAccessorType(XmlAccessType.FIELD)    @XmlRootElement  @XmlType(name = "Employee", propOrder = { "name", "age", "role", "gender" })   public class Employee {      private String name;          private String gender;          private int age;          private String role;          public String getName() {              return name;      }    public void setName(String name) {              this.name = name;      }    public String getGender() {              return gender;      }    public void setGender(String gender) {              this.gender = gender;      }    public int getAge() {              return age;      }    public void setAge(int age) {              this.age = age;      }    public String getRole() {              return role;      }    public void setRole(String role) {              this.role = role;      }    @Override      public String toString() {              return "Employee:: Name=" + this.name + " Age=" + this.age + " Gender="                  + this.gender + " Role=" + this.role;      }    }
<?xml version="1.0"?><employee id="1">      <name>Pankaj</name>      <age>29</age>      <role>Java Developer</role>      <gender>Male</gender></employee>
package net.csdn.test;  import java.io.InputStream;  import java.io.StringReader;  import java.io.StringWriter;  import javax.xml.bind.JAXBContext;  import javax.xml.bind.Marshaller;  import javax.xml.bind.Unmarshaller;  import net.csdn.beans.Employee;  import org.junit.Test;public class TestJAXB {      @Test      public void testXml2Obj() throws Exception {          InputStream is = Thread.currentThread().getContextClassLoader().getResourceAsStream("employee.xml");          byte[] bytes = new byte[is.available()];          is.read(bytes);          String xmlStr = new String(bytes);          JAXBContext context = JAXBContext.newInstance(Employee.class);            Unmarshaller unmarshaller = context.createUnmarshaller();            Employee emp = (Employee) unmarshaller.unmarshal(new StringReader(xmlStr));          System.out.println(emp);      }        @Test      public void testObj2Xml() {          Employee  emp = new Employee();          emp.setAge(10);          emp.setGender("Male");          emp.setName("Jane");          emp.setRole("Teacher");          String xmlStr = TestJAXB.convertToXml(emp,"utf-8");            System.out.println(xmlStr);      }        public static String convertToXml(Object obj, String encoding) {            String result = null;            try {                JAXBContext context = JAXBContext.newInstance(obj.getClass());                Marshaller marshaller = context.createMarshaller();                marshaller.setProperty(Marshaller.JAXB_FORMATTED_OUTPUT, true);                marshaller.setProperty(Marshaller.JAXB_ENCODING, encoding);                  StringWriter writer = new StringWriter();                marshaller.marshal(obj, writer);                result = writer.toString();            } catch (Exception e) {                e.printStackTrace();            }              return result;        }     }

运行testObj2Xml测试方法,控制台输出:

<?xml version="1.0" encoding="utf-8" standalone="yes"?><employee>      <name>Jane</name>      <age>10</age>      <role>Teacher</role>      <gender>Male</gender></employee>

运行testXml2Obj测试方法,控制台输出:

Employee:: Name=Pankaj Age=29 Gender=Male Role=Java Developer

注:本例中使用JUnit4作为单元测试工具,在Eclipse中点击Window->Show View->OutLine菜单打开outline视图,分别在testXml2Obj和testObj2Xml方法上点击右键->Run As->JUnit Test即可。
